A large-scale building complex in the District 53 section of the Minato Mirai 21 Central Zone in Yokohama started construction in April 2021. The over 180,000 square meter project consists of two mixed-use buildings, along with an activated plaza, and a covered connection with the nearby transit station.

The West Building will have 30 floors above ground and a height of about 158 meters. It will be primarily office space, with 3,360-square-meter floor plates. The Keikyu EX Hotel is the planned tenancy of the upper floors. The East Building office building will have 16 floors above ground and a height of about 84 meters, with 2,796 square meter floor plates. The lower floors will consist of retail and restaurants.

An open common space will be activated with the concept of “rambling,” with renderings showing a grand staircase and outdoor lounge structures.

The Minato Mirai 21 Central District 53 Block Development project is scheduled to complete at the end of March 2024.
